
Luz Community Development Coalition was established on July 4,2003. The Coalition serves the Latino community of Clark County by providing a forum in which interested organizations, agencies, and individuals can work in unison to support a healthy community through education, assessment, communication, and evaluation by supporting prevention programs that will benefit the communities.
Effective July of 2007, Luz received our status as a recognized 501c3 non-profit organization. We have developed prevention education and public awareness of substance related issues within our community by facilitating the development and implementation of a comprehensive prevention plan to coordinate prevention strategies and activities throughout our service area.
Luz will continue to build our prevention capacity and infrastructure through the expansion of our partnerships, cultivation of prevention systems, collaborative initiatives within the service population, the leveraging of, and access to existing resources and the identification of strategies designed to address and reduce substance use and a multitude of other issues within the Latino community.
